Enbrel tuberculosis warning expanded

Enbrel’s prescribing information will now have a black box warning to highlight the small but potentially serious risk of infections, including tuberculosis.

In U.S. and Canadian clinical trials, the rate of tuberculosis infection has been roughly 0.007% of patients, or about 1 in 14,000 cases; but in actual practice, rare cases of tuberculosis have been seen in patients using tumor necrosis factor (TNF) inhibitors like Enbrel, Remicade and Humira.

It’s a good reminder that patients should be screened for active and latent TB before beginning anti-TNF psoriasis treatments and periodically during treatment.
